Svetlana Savitskaya

Svetlana Savitskaya is a cosmonaut who was born on August 8, 1948, in Moscow.

Savitskaya became a cosmonaut in 1980. She has spent over 20 days in space on two spaceflights. In 1982, Savitskaya became the second woman in space when she flew aboard Soyuz T-7.

Savitskaya made her second flight aboard the Salyut 7 space station in 1984. She became the first woman to walk in space during this flight.
